➀ Gitai USA, a space robotics startup, has raised $15.5 million in its latest Series B Extension round. This brings the total raised in Series B Extension rounds to $60.5 million. ➁ The lead investor in this round was Maezawa Fund, operated by Japanese billionaire entrepreneur Yusaku Maezawa. ➃ Gitai USA plans to use the additional funding to advance on-orbit services and lunar infrastructure construction in the U.S. space and defense market.
➀ Optimum Technologies has secured a contract from the U.S. Space Force for an optical imaging payload. The payload is for the VICTUS SURGO mission, scheduled for 2026 launch. ➁ The contract is worth $4.5 million and is a Small Business Innovation Research (SBIR) Phase 3 agreement. ➂ The payload includes a telescope, camera, processing electronics, and software, to be built at the company's expanded satellite manufacturing facility.
➀ Sony Space Communications Corporation and Astro Digital are partnering to design, manufacture, and launch two micro-satellites for laser communication; ➁ The satellites will showcase SSCC's optical communication technology and push for laser communication to become the industry standard for space comms; ➂ The collaboration aims to address the need for efficient and reliable communication in space exploration.
➀ Spire Global has won a contract from NASA’s Jet Propulsion Laboratory to improve wildfire detection; ➁ The company will work with OroraTech to develop an early detection and active monitoring system; ➂ The system aims to provide near real-time satellite data for improved decision-making and response times in fire management.
➀ Orbit Fab, specializing in spacecraft refueling systems, has partnered with four space sector companies; ➁ The agreements aim to deepen partnerships and expand expertise in spacecraft technology, propulsion, and in-orbit servicing; ➂ Orbit Fab's focus is on extending the lifespan of satellites, moving away from the single-use paradigm; ➃ The partnerships were signed at the International Astronautical Congress (IAC) in Milan.

➀ India's Bellatrix Aerospace has announced a spacecraft plan to operate at altitudes below 200 kilometers with the goal of launching its first satellite by 2026.
➁ The ultra-low Earth orbit (LEO) satellites offer benefits such as higher resolution imaging for Earth observation applications and reduced communication latency for supporting 6G telecommunications networks.
➂ Bellatrix has developed an air-breathing electric propulsion system to address the challenge of atmospheric drag at these altitudes.
➀ Ramon.Space has been chosen for a UK Space Agency-funded program to develop its NuComm onboard processor; ➁ The processor is designed for large-scale communication satellite constellations and will deliver high-capacity, low-power digital communication systems; ➂ The modular, software-defined platform allows for in-orbit updates and reconfiguration, enhancing operational efficiency and resilience.

1. The UK Space Agency has announced £10.9 million in funding for five Scottish space sector projects. 2. Major projects include a sub-orbital rocket test by HyImpulse and technology development by Spire Global for unique weather forecasting data. 3. Additional 'Kick Starter' projects focus on lunar exploration energy resources, low noise amplifier technology, and a modular astro-robotic system.

1. IENAI Space, a Madrid-based startup, has raised €3.9 million in its latest funding round to develop electric propulsion technologies. 2. The total funding now stands at €7 million, with investors including Inveready, WA4STEAM, DPM, GED Conexo Ventures, and CDTI. 3. The company plans to expand its manufacturing and testing facilities across Europe and increase its workforce from 22 to 30 employees.
